I fitted Grande Punto wind deflectors to mine and they fit perfectly. :D

As for bulbs check your handbook for the bulb type to make sure you order the right one’s if you choose to upgrade.
There’s been a fair few of us on the forum upgrade our bulbs, headlight, sidelight & DRL’s… the fog lights are a bit of a nightmare so I left those ones alone.
Point to note is that some parts are the same as the Grande but many do have slight differences so be careful. (y)

I got my deflectors off eBay, I went for the Heko (think they’re German) ones as they have a slightly darker tint than the Fiat ones.
As for bulbs… eBay for the Mtec DRL’s and I went for Osram Nighbreaker headlights for power rather than colour although they do give a nice white light & Osram cool blue sidelights… although you could probably get better than them.

TJ... the Heko deflectors you've got... did you have to put any clips in the wndow or sill ? tar.. Andre
Yeah they came with clips that slip in... I put the clips on with the deflectors on the Evo, having said that I had the same brand of deflectors on my old 100HP Panda and didn’t bother fitting the clips on it, can’t seem to notice the difference to be honest!
They held on the Panda just the same as the Evo.

Oh yeah... they also have small sticky pads to hold them in position too!!

Cool, but :confused:I'm just a bit warey about putting clips in the sill, and scratching window etc.
I can understand you not wanting to risk scratching the window… it’s a valid point! I’ve just checked on mine and there is no scratching on the glass (I’ve had mine fitted since May), the clips slip into the top where the deflector fits in, so I would imagine that if any scratching did occur it could only occur to the top edge (about 1cm) of the glass, as the rest of the window would not come into contact with them.
On my Panda I only used the sticky pads to fit them and they stayed on perfectly, so you could always try fitting them without using the clips first and see how they hold.
I bought my old man a pair of Genuine Fiat ones for his Grande Sporting and they are only very lightly smoked (and twice the price) whereas the Heko ones have a darker tint so that’s why I opted for them.
Really it just comes down to personal choice though.(y)
